Joint Status Report: American Oversight v. State — State Department Officials’ Ukraine Communications

October 30, 2019
Joint status report filed by American Oversight and the Department of State regarding American Oversight’s lawsuit against the agency for Ukraine-related records including senior officials' communications with Rudy Giuliani. In the filing, the State Department agrees to release multiple categories of Ukraine-related records to American Oversight by November 22, 2019. 

Opinion and Order Granting Motion: American Oversight v. State – Ukraine Communications

October 25, 2019
Opinion and order from the U.S. District Court for the District of Columbia partially granting American Oversight's motion seeking a preliminary injunction to compel the rapid release of State Department records related to President Trump's effort to pressure Ukraine. The court orders the State Department to work with American Oversight to narrow the scope of our FOIA requests and to process and release all non-exempt documents from the narrowed requests on or before November 22, 2019.
